#include "lldb/Utility/UserIDResolver.h"
#include "gmock/gmock.h"
#include <optional>
using namespace lldb_private;
using namespace testing;
namespace {
class TestUserIDResolver : public UserIDResolver {
public:
MOCK_METHOD1(DoGetUserName, std::optional<std::string>(id_t uid));
MOCK_METHOD1(DoGetGroupName, std::optional<std::string>(id_t gid));
};
}
TEST(UserIDResolver, GetUserName) {
StrictMock<TestUserIDResolver> r;
llvm::StringRef user47("foo");
EXPECT_CALL(r, DoGetUserName(47)).Times(1).WillOnce(Return(user47.str()));
EXPECT_CALL(r, DoGetUserName(42)).Times(1).WillOnce(Return(std::nullopt));
EXPECT_EQ(user47, r.GetUserName(47));
EXPECT_EQ(user47, r.GetUserName(47));
EXPECT_EQ(std::nullopt, r.GetUserName(42));
EXPECT_EQ(std::nullopt, r.GetUserName(42));
}
TEST(UserIDResolver, GetGroupName) {
StrictMock<TestUserIDResolver> r;
llvm::StringRef group47("foo");
EXPECT_CALL(r, DoGetGroupName(47)).Times(1).WillOnce(Return(group47.str()));
EXPECT_CALL(r, DoGetGroupName(42)).Times(1).WillOnce(Return(std::nullopt));
EXPECT_EQ(group47, r.GetGroupName(47));
EXPECT_EQ(group47, r.GetGroupName(47));
EXPECT_EQ(std::nullopt, r.GetGroupName(42));
EXPECT_EQ(std::nullopt, r.GetGroupName(42));
}
